Ho Chi Minh City's Department of Construction is launching an investigation into a transport company after a bus fire in Đồng Nai province claimed seven lives on July 21. The department has identified potential regulatory violations related to the operation of the bus involved in the fatal incident.
The fire occurred early on July 21 on National Highway 1 in Hưng Thịnh commune, Đồng Nai province. The bus, bearing license plate 50E - 447.02, was carrying passengers when it caught fire. Following the tragedy, the Department of Construction initiated a probe into the vehicle and the operating company, Công ty TNHH thương mại và dịch vụ vận tải N.L (N.L Company Ltd.).
Initial findings suggest the company may have operated the vehicle improperly. According to the Department of Construction's report to the Ho Chi Minh City People's Committee, N.L Company Ltd. was registered in November 2025. The company holds permits for various transport services, including fixed-route passenger transport, contract passenger transport, and freight transport. The specific bus involved was manufactured in 2026 and had a valid inspection certificate until January 2028.
However, the department noted that the bus's route, departing from a branch office in Khánh Hòa and heading to another branch office in Ho Chi Minh City, may violate regulations. Specifically, it could contravene Decree No. 158/2024/ND-CP, which prohibits drivers from picking up or dropping off passengers at company headquarters or branch offices. Consequently, the Department of Construction has issued an order for a surprise inspection of N.L Company Ltd. to ensure compliance with transport business regulations.
